Licensing And Regulation At PlayKasino
PlayKasino operates under a gambling licence issued by the Curaçao Gaming Control Board (GCB). The licence sets the legal basis for offering casino games online and makes the operator accountable to a regulator if it breaches licence conditions.
The licence regulates who can run the casino, how the games are offered, and how player funds are handled. In practice, this covers identity checks, record-keeping, complaint handling, and rules for how deposits, bonuses, and withdrawals are processed.
Game fairness is regulated through requirements to use certified random number generators for RNG-based games. For a player, this means outcomes must come from audited game software rather than manual control by the casino.
Anti-money laundering rules apply to payments and withdrawals. PlayKasino must verify identity in cases such as higher-value withdrawals, unusual payment patterns, or mismatched payment methods, so players should expect KYC checks before certain cashouts are approved.
Responsible gambling controls are part of licensing conditions. This typically includes tools such as deposit limits, session limits,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ion, which give the player a way to reduce access without needing support from payment providers.
Marketing and bonus terms are regulated as contract terms the casino must publish and follow. For a player, this means wagering requirements, game exclusions, maximum cashout rules, and withdrawal fees should be stated in the bonus terms and can be used to dispute incorrect deductions.
Data handling is regulated through the operator’s privacy and security obligations. This affects how PlayKasino stores identity documents, payment details, and gameplay history, and it limits who can access that information inside the company.

Responsible Gambling At PlayKasino
PlayKasino sets account-level controls that reduce overspending and time loss. Limits apply immediately for decreases, while increases take effect after a 24-hour cooling-off period.
- Limits: Players can set deposit limits ($25–$10,000) on daily, weekly, or monthly cycles; loss limits ($25–$10,000) for the same periods; wagering limits ($50–$50,000) per day; and session time limits from 15 minutes to 12 hours. PlayKasino also offers a maximum single deposit cap of $5,000 and a maximum stake cap of $500 per spin for slots and $2,000 per hand for live table games, both enforced at the account level.
- Self-exclusion: PlayKasino provides a one-click self-exclusion tool with fixed terms of 24 hours, 7 days, 30 days, 6 months, and 12 months, plus an indefinite option. During self-exclusion, logins are blocked, marketing messages stop within 24 hours, withdrawals remain available for verified accounts, and any attempt to create a new account is closed after identity checks.
